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95898 0113 681599 4812780218
8858 5980743 14238430955
8858 5980743 14238430955
9952684591 6969 63 121605714
All about undefined
Interested in learning more?
8858 5980743 14238430955
9952684591 6969 63 121605714
See more
915 567
8861 46901974984 9473408 58
See more
0618687465 497
0087666 730628397 30604127
See more